Understanding the Market
Growth of Online Medical Supply Market in Canada
The online medical supply market in Canada has seen significant growth over the past few years. This expansion has been driven by technological advancements, increased internet accessibility, and a growing preference for online shopping. As a result, a wide range of medical supplies, from basic first-aid kits to advanced medical devices, is now available at the click of a button.
Key Players in the Canadian Market
Several key players dominate the Canadian online medical supply market. These include well-established companies like Medline Canada, McKesson Canada, and Cardinal Health Canada. Knowing the major suppliers can help you identify reliable sources for quality medical supplies.
Regulations and Standards
Health Canada\'s Role in Ensuring Quality
Health Canada plays a pivotal role in regulating medical supplies in the country. They set stringent standards to ensure that all medical products, including those sold online, are safe and effective. Familiarize yourself with Health Canada\'s guidelines and look for products that comply with these regulations.
Compliance with International Standards
In addition to national regulations, many high-quality medical supplies adhere to international standards set by organizations such as the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) and the World Health Organization (WHO). Products that meet these standards are generally reliable and safe to use.
Researching Suppliers
Checking Supplier Credentials
Before making a purchase, it\'s essential to research the supplier. Check their credentials, including certifications, industry affiliations, and business licenses. Reputable suppliers will provide this information readily on their websites or upon request.
Reading Reviews and Testimonials
Customer reviews and testimonials can offer valuable insights into the quality of a supplier\'s products and services. Look for detailed feedback from other healthcare professionals or patients to gauge the reliability of the supplier.
Quality Assurance Practices
Certification and Accreditation
Certification and accreditation from recognized bodies are indicators of a supplier\'s commitment to quality. Look for suppliers who have certifications from organizations such as ISO or have been accredited by industry-specific bodies.
Third-Party Testing
Third-party testing is another crucial quality assurance practice. Independent laboratories can verify the quality and safety of medical supplies, providing an additional layer of assurance.
Evaluating Product Information
Detailed Product Descriptions
A trustworthy supplier will provide detailed product descriptions, including specifications, materials used, and intended use. This information helps you understand what you\'re purchasing and ensures it meets your needs.
Understanding Product Specifications
Pay close attention to product specifications, such as size, weight, and compatibility with other equipment. These details are critical to ensuring that the product will function correctly in your specific context.

Cost vs. Quality
Balancing Affordability and Quality
While it\'s tempting to opt for cheaper options, it\'s essential to balance affordability with quality. Inexpensive products may compromise on quality, potentially leading to ineffective treatments or safety issues.
Avoiding Counterfeit Products
Counterfeit medical supplies are a significant concern in the online market. Be cautious of prices that seem too good to be true and verify the authenticity of the products through the supplier\'s credentials and customer reviews.
